Sans Study of the Unilamellar DMPC Vesicles. the Fluctuation Model of Lipid Bilayer
TL;DR: In this article, a sigmoid distribution function of the water molecules was calculated to explain why lipid membrane is easy penetrated by water molecules and the results of fitting of the experimental data obtained at the small angle spectrometer SANS-I, PSI (Switzerland) are: average vesicle radius 272 angstrom, polydispersity of the radius 27%, membrane thickness 50.6 angstrom and number of water molecules located per lipid molecule 13.4 angstrom.
